eBay Image Requirements for Guitar Amplifier
Clean, clear product shot on white or light background. For used items, condition documentation shots are critical.
- Minimum 500px on the longest side (1600px+ strongly recommended)
- Up to 24 images per listing (12 free)
- Supported formats: JPEG, PNG
- White background not mandatory, but recommended for new items
- No borders, text, or watermarks on images
- Zoom feature activates at 800px+ on longest side
eBay Photography Tips for Guitar Amplifier
For new items: follow Amazon-style white background photography for maximum professionalism.
For used/vintage items: show EVERY flaw, scratch, and sign of wear — undisclosed condition issues are the leading cause of eBay disputes.
Use maximum available image slots — the more angles and detail shots, the higher the buyer confidence.
eBay's Best Offer and auction formats benefit from aspirational lifestyle photography that justifies your price.
High-resolution zoom is extremely valuable on eBay — buyers often zoom to verify condition before bidding.
